Hello all. Ive been playing around with using Huron for a while now and would like some critique on the list. The main idea is to have Huron Blackheart Infiltrate noise marines into cover and be in maximum firing range for the sonic blasters. The second unit of 10 and if I'm lucky on the master of deception roll, Obliterators or Havocs (depending on the opponent) will accompany them. Slaanesh lord on a his steed will outflank with the 20 man noise marine squad while the Termicide units take out any big armor with their Meltas. Aegis Quad Gun can be maned by Havocs or the small noise marine squad.
I dont know where to put Huron himself in this list. I have only been playing 40k since dark vengeance so any advice is welcome!

Sorry for my long winded ness in this post. Figure it would be better to explain my thoughts rather than post a army list since you said you're fairly new. You may not agree with all of it but I hope it helps. Happy hunting  .
I have been liking Slaanesh and it's noise weapons alot lately with the introduction of the Taudar (Tau and Elda players) since those armies tend to THRIVES on cover saves and sonic weapons tend to shut that nonsense down quite quickly.
That being said I only consider myself to be a novice since I am just recently coming back into the game myself. But at first glance I would drop the VoLW and the steed on your Lord since if you do decide to outflank instead of infiltrating them the odds are your not going to get a ideal flank position and your blob squad of marines will be easy pickings for any army. If you really want to get those guys into close combat, drop the unit size to 9 tops so you can put them and a IC with them in a Rhino or Landraider with dirge casters to PREVENT enemies from overwatching. Give the Noise Marine champ, that you want to assault with, and your Lord powerfist or powersword/melta bombs, I'd recommend fists for tough opponents and MC's though. You might also want to consider taking Lucian over your lord as well would be cheaper than the lord you have listed and far better in CC, I have also successfully used Lucian as a bog unit to tie up elder wrath knights, a 300 point bamf, with my 165 point IC from turn 2 till the end of the game. Food for thought on your assault unit and hq's. Blackheart is more utility to me though. Run him around in a rhino with a doom siren on a champion and flame on from firing ports.
As for your terminators, deep strike them with balls of steel or drop them for additional troops. They will not get their points worth if you foot slog them and even if you do deep strike them it's a toss up if they will get their point value. If you do wish to take terminators though, I haven't tested this in game yet but in theory it is sound. Take 10 of them with a heavy flame, reaper auto and the rest combi-weapons and put a sorcerer lvl 3 with term armour and do your damndest to get the telepathy spell Invisibility. That way when you deep strike into cover you have a 2++. Which is nice. Also if you really wanted to make them a deathstar give them MoS and drop a IoE for that feel no pain.
As far as troops and Noise marines go I would max out your organization chart. 1 champ vanilla, unless you want him accompanying a IC, a blastmaster and 4 sonic blasters. Got to use that Slaanesh revered number of six. I'm a sucker for lore. That will give you six blastmasters, plenty of firepower for any army and they are troops. Drop your havocs since blastmasters>autocannons. Still take a aegis with quad though and put a squad of noise marines in there. If you are planning on getting rhinos for mobile cover then keep saturating armour with armour in heavy support. Otherwise keep your havocs in aegis and blast away.

Get Icons for your 10man sonic squads. They're giving you effectively 33% more bodies (assuming you get FnP against all wounds), so it works out cheaper to just buy the Icon than an extra 3 dudes.
Dump Huron into the Oblit squad when possible - He'll make them fearless, and they'll give him a bit of a wound soak to help deny Slay the Warlord.
Your anti-vehicle is very very light. Might want to think about shoring that up a little. How do you plan on dealing with things like LR's, Russes, Necron vehicles etc? Basically anything AV13+ isn't going to feel very threatened with what you have on the table, and at 2k+ points, you're pretty likely to see a reasonable amount of armour.

Except 2 Las Preds in the above list would get obliterated within 2 turns, since they're the only ground based vehicles on the field, and without target saturation, his opponent will be pointing every anti vehicle weapon he has at them.
In such an infantry heavy list, I'd look at Lascannon Havocs. 155 points for a basic 5man squad with 4 lascannons is pretty good.
Your current lineup (Oblits/Termicide) gives you, over the course of the game, 6 melta shots and 9 lascannon shots, plus potentially an additional 6 melta shots if you get your oblits close enough. That's not per turn. That's 15-21 anti-vehicle shots over the entire game (assuming none of your stuff dies, which isn't going to happen realistically) 1/3 of those shots miss by default simply due to BS4. A single lascannon havoc squad will give you 20 shots over 5 turns (again, assuming the unrealistic situation where none of them die), which is more than quadrupling your 48" firepower.
They'll still be vulnerable to having anti vehicle weapons shot at them, but you're at least saturating your infantry targets, and they remove that small chance of having all your firepower vaporised with one lucky lascannon shot.
Whether you elect to go for lashavocs is up to you. Melta Raptors or bikers could also be an option. LasPreds are not. You don't have enough other vehicles to give them the target saturation they need to do their job in my opinion, and to add those other vehicles would basically require you to take the list right back to square one and start again.
